Eh, depends on how you look at it. I leased mine for one big reason. I live in a big city and accidents happen all the time. All cars I've owned have been rear ended or side swiped, all not any fault of mine. One car had frame damage, and I returned the lease no problem. Wouldn't want to own that car. Could I have bought it? Sure. To each their own though.
